What is Mobile Truck Advertising?


Truck advertising involves placing marketing messages on the sides of trucks or other vehicles. These mobile units then drive through strategic routes, exposing the message to thousands of potential customers on a consistent basis.

Why Choose Mobile Truck Advertising?


Using mobile billboards offers a unique edge over traditional static advertising. Here are some compelling benefits:

  • Greater reach and impressions

  • Affordable for local and national campaigns

  • Flexible route planning

  • Hard to ignore or skip

Cost of Mobile Truck Advertising


Here’s Visit Site a general range:

  • Standard mobile billboard (vinyl wrap): $1,000–$3,000 per week

  • Digital LED truck: $2,500–$7,000+ per week

  • Custom experiential truck: pricing on request
